Household of Neeltjen Willemsz. van Wees

She is married to Evert Cornelisz. de Haes.

Permission for the marriage has been obtained in Abcoude-Proostdij, Gemeente De Ronde Venen, Utrecht, Nederland on January 14, 1725.

They got married on January 31, 1725 at Abcoude-Proostdij, Gemeente De Ronde Venen, Utrecht, Nederland.


Child(ren):

  1. Crelis de Haas  1726-????
  2. Geertrudis de Haes  1731-????
  3. Wilhelmius de Haes  1733-< 1735
  4. Wilhelmus de Haes  1735-????
  5. Maria de Haes  1737-????
